Background technique
In blasting engineering work progress, since geological conditions causes to influence the dress of explosive with the presence of water in the blasthole of part
It fills out and demolition effect, area is promoted slower in south China, and the present apparatus may be mounted on any engineering vehicle chassis, in powder charge
Before, by blasthole water is drained.The mode that mine drainage of explosive hole mainly takes pressure-air to blow at present, the drainage pattern have as follows
Disadvantage: draining is not thorough, and it is more that bottom hole remains water;The water of discharge, which is all gathered in, to be eated dishes without rice or wine nearby or flows back into blasthole, and ground is polluted,
It is unfavorable for subsequent charging;It is unfriendly to operator, in the mud underwater work largely to splash.

Working principle: technical problems based on background technology, the present invention propose blasthole water plug, and structure is simple,
Easy for installation, operation is easy, and solves the problems, such as blasting hole with water powder charge.
The present invention proposed by the present invention includes including pumping system, coil system, support system, rotary system, dynamical system
System and control system;Water pump 16 is mounted on water pipe one end, is put into blasthole bottom with water pipe when drawing water, and water pump 16 is that bottom is slightly narrow,
Prevent blasthole falling rocks from nipping water pump 16, one-way check valve is installed at 16 media outlet of water pump, and direction prevents water far from water pump 16
After pump 16 stops, the aqueous reflux in water pipe is returned in blasthole, there is three signal pipes inside water pipe;Two 16 power signal pipes of water pump,
A piece sensor signal pipe, pipe dish 1 are installed on fixed bracket 12 by an axis, are freely rotatable, and coil pipe motor 3 is installed on
On fixed bracket 12, it is connected with pipe dish 1, can realizes the folding and unfolding of water pipe by the forward and reverse of pipe dish 1;The rotation of high pressure four-way
5 one end of adapter is fixed in pipe dish 1, and the other end is fixed on fixed bracket 12, and pipe dish 1 terminates water flowing and pumps 16 water pipes 14, water
Pump 16 hydraulic oil inlet pipes, 16 hydraulic oil outlet pipe of water pump, sensor signal outlet;Bracket end connects drainpipe 9, water pump 16
7 hydraulic oil inlet pipe of controller, 16 controller of water pump, 7 hydraulic oil outlet pipe, sensor signal inlet tube;In four-way medium with
Signal is mutually indepedent, and support system includes fixed bracket 12 and telescope support 11, and fixed bracket 12 is mounted on automobile chassis, can
Rotation;Telescope support 11 can free extension as needed, meet the needs of field operation, rotation gear 8 is fixed on fixed bracket
On 12, rotation motor 10 is fixed on automobile chassis, is connected with rotation gear 8;Can by the forward and reverse of rotation motor 10,
The rotation for realizing fixed bracket 12, meets the needs of field operation.Water pump 16 is connected by the first power signal pipe 6 with controller 7
It connects, telescope support 11 is connect by the second power signal pipe 2 with controller 7, and coil pipe motor 3 passes through third power signal pipe 4 three
It is connect with controller 7, rotation motor 10 is connect by the 4th power signal pipe 18 with controller 7.Each dynamic component power signal
Pipe is mutually indepedent, can control separately through controller 7 is crossed.Controller 7 is connected by 19 power source of the 5th power signal pipe.Control
Device 7 can analyze whether blasthole bottom water is drained according to first sensor 17 and second sensor 20, pump trip when draining, concurrently
Specific vision or audible signal out.Remind site operation personnel.
The water pump 16 that the present invention uses uses special construction water pump 16, and power signal pipe is located in water outlet, and can pacify
Fill signal transducer;In the present invention, controller 7 can be known by 16 outer sensors of water pump and the pressure change of water outlet sensor
Other blasthole bottom water is to be drained, and can be realized autostop.
